Cracked foundation repair services address issues caused by settling, shifting, or other structural stresses that lead to visible cracks or damage in a property’s foundation. These repairs typically involve stabilizing the foundation, filling cracks, and sometimes underpinning or reinforcement to restore stability. Projects can range from minor surface cracks to more extensive foundation settling or bowing walls, and the goal is to prevent further damage, maintain property value, and ensure safety.
Property owners considering foundation repair usually want to understand the signs indicating the need for service, such as u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, or doors and windows that don't close properly.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- seals and stabilizes small to large cracks to prevent further damage.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- reinforces and lifts sagging or settling pier and beam structures.
Slab Foundation Repair - addresses uneven or cracked concrete slabs to restore stability.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and stabilizes foundations affected by shifting or settling soils.
Wall Stabilization - reinforces basement and crawl space walls to prevent bowing or collapse.
Drainage and Waterproofing - improves soil conditions around foundations to reduce water damage risks.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of a cracked foundation?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
Is foundation cracking a serious issue? Yes, it can indicate structural problems that may worsen over time if not addressed promptly.
What causes foundation cracks? Causes include soil movement, poor drainage, and settling of the building over time.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or other stabilization methods to restore stability.
